Assumed Certainty: Multi-Attribute Decision Making (MADM)

Scenario: You are the Vice President of Franchise Services for the Lucky restaurant chain. You have been assigned the task of evaluating the best location for a new Lucky restaurant. The CFO has provided you with a template that includes 6 criteria (attributes) that you are required to use in your evaluation of 5 recommended locations. Following are the 6 criteria that you will use to evaluate this decision:

Traffic counts (avg. thousands/day)-the more traffic, the more customers, and the greater the potential sales.

Building lease and taxes (thousands $ per year)-the lower the building lease and taxes, the better.

Size of building (square feet in thousands)-a larger building is more preferable.

Parking spaces (max number of customers parking)-more customer parking is preferable.

Insurance costs (thousands $ per year)-lower insurance costs are preferable.

Ease of access (subjective evaluation from observation)-you will need to "code" the subjective data. Use Excellent = 4, Good = 3, Fair = 2, and Poor = 1.
